Ceiling-Access Lay-In UtilityPackage.ConnectionsBracket attaches theutility carrier to the lay-inhorizontal connecting bar.Ceiling-access lay-inutility package can beinstalled in in-line, L, T, V, X,Y, and end-of-run panelconfigurations. End-of-runcondition reduces cablecapacity..Quick-lock mechanismon the lay-in horizontalconnecting bar engages thejunction in a tight structuralconnection. Quick-lockmechanism is the same ason the standard horizontalconnecting bars.Wiring & CablingLocal electrical codesvary. Consult a qualifiedelectrical contractor orengineer for the properinstallation of all electricalcomponents.Ceiling-access lay-inutility package wasdesigned to be used with<strong>Answer</strong> power harnesses.If using any other type ofconduit, the diameter of theconduit cannot be greaterthan 1 ⁄2". Skins will notinstall properly if conduitexceeds 1 ⁄2".Horizontal routingthrough junctions is accommodatedby openings formodular harnesses andcables.
